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ation underpinning - stabilizes and reinforces sinking foundations to prevent further movement.
Pier and beam repair - restores support for homes with sagging or uneven floors caused by shifting soil.
Mudjacking and leveling - lifts and levels sunken concrete slabs around the property.
Wall stabilization - prevents cracking and bowing in basement and foundation walls.
Soil stabilization - improves soil conditions to reduce future foundation settlement.
Drainage correction - manages water flow to minimize soil erosion and foundation damage.
Sinking Foundation Repair Questions
What causes a sinking foundation? Soil movement, poor drainage, and changes in moisture levels can lead to foundation settling and sinking.
How can I tell if my foundation is sinking? Signs include uneven floors, cracked walls, and sticking doors or windows.
Is foundation sinking a safety concern? Yes, ongoing sinking can compromise structural integrity and should be evaluated by a professional.
What types of projects involve sinking foundation repair? Common projects include lifting and leveling slabs, stabilizing bowing walls, and addressing uneven basement floors.
